ODFW Looks To Add To South Coyote Unit In Fern Ridge Wildlife Area
The Oregon Department of Fish and Wildlife wants public input on land acquisitions in the Fern Ridge area west of Eugene. The parcels would be accessible to the public and be part of the Willamette Wildlife Mitigation Program. The acquisition would add 140 acres to the South Coyote unit of the Fern Ridge Wildlife Area managed by ODFW.
